Step-by-Step: Building Your First NTLite Mega ISO
Ready to build your own? Here is the workflow for a "Full Mega" gaming OS.
Prerequisites:
- Windows 10/11 Pro ISO (Retail)
- NTLite Full (Licensed)
- 20GB free HDD space
- Virtual Machine for testing (VMware or Hyper-V)
Step 1: Extract the ISO
Use 7-Zip to extract the Windows ISO into a folder (e.g., C:\WinISO).
Step 2: Load in NTLite
Open NTLite. Drag the C:\WinISO folder into the interface. Load your install.wim (usually "Windows 11 Pro").
Step 3: Integrate (Optional but recommended) Go to the "Updates" tab. Add the latest Servicing Stack and Cumulative Update so your Mega OS is patched on day one.
Step 4: The Mega Removal (Components) Navigate to the "Components" tab. Check "Safe" removal preset, then manually uncheck anything you need. For a Mega build, check these categories:
- All Hardware Support: Remove "Modem support," "Fax," "Infrared," "Printing" (unless you have a printer).
- System Apps: Remove Edge, Cortana, OneDrive, Windows Mail, Calculator (replace with third-party).
- Network: Remove "SMB 1.0/CIFS," "Work Folders Client."
- Privacy: Remove "Telemetry Client," "Windows Error Reporting."
Step 5: Tweaks (Registry)
- Explorer: Disable Shortcut suffix, Disable Automatic Updates.
- Services: Disable SysMain (Superfetch) and Windows Search (if using SSD).
- Privacy: Enable "Disable Telemetry" (Set to 0 - Security).
Step 6: Apply & Save Click "Process." Select the output folder. Ensure "Create ISO" is checked. Click "Start." In the digital shadows, NTLite isn't just a
Result: A custom ISO. Install it. You will land on a desktop in 30 seconds, using roughly 600MB of RAM on Windows 10.
1. The Full (Paid) License
NTLite has a free mode, but it is heavily restricted. The free version allows you to edit images but prevents you from saving your changes if you remove components beyond a basic level. The "Full" aspect refers to having a paid license key—unlocking the ability to save, export, and deploy your custom ISO.
